Daniel Perlov

December 28, 1955 - October 24, 2020

We created a memorial to celebrate the life of a good friend and colleague, Daniel Perlov. Due to Covid, there will be no public memorial, however, collecting your stories and memories here will offer great comfort for the family. Thank you for contributing to this lasting memorial.
